Skip to content

CI: Attach project binary to release page#4

Merged
andy-k-improving merged 8 commits intomainfrom
ft-dist-job
Aug 12, 2025
Merged

CI: Attach project binary to release page#4
andy-k-improving merged 8 commits intomainfrom
ft-dist-job

Conversation

@andy-k-improving
Copy link
Copy Markdown
Contributor

Summary 📝

This is the PR to update existing release pipeline to perform the following:

  • Attach project whl file as part of the release asset
  • Comment out the Pypi publish job to avoid failure

Test plan:

  • Create a test release tag on this branch and observe the release page and make sure .whl file is now one of the asset.

Comment thread .github/workflows/release.yml Outdated
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
Signed-off-by: Andy Kwok <andy.kwok@improving.com>
@andy-k-improving andy-k-improving merged commit 8cffc36 into main Aug 12, 2025
5 of 6 checks passed
@andy-k-improving andy-k-improving deleted the ft-dist-job branch April 8, 2026 23:19
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ants